Chloe Kelly Joins England Squad for Nations League Games

- Arsenal's Chloe Kelly and Aston Villa midfielder Lucy Parker have been called up to the England squad for the upcoming Nations League fixtures.

Chloe Kelly and Lucy Parker Join England Squad

Arsenal's Chloe Kelly and Aston Villa midfielder Lucy Parker have been named as replacements in the England squad for the Nations League games, filling in for injured players Beth Mead and Lotte Wubben-Moy. Kelly, who recently moved from Manchester City to Arsenal, was initially left out of the squad due to lack of game time, but her impressive debut for Arsenal earned her a spot. Parker, on the other hand, played a full 90 minutes in Villa's recent match against Leicester City.

Injuries and Replacements

Beth Mead and Lotte Wubben-Moy had to withdraw from the squad due to injuries. Mead, who has been dealing with a calf strain, was an unused substitute in the last game for Arsenal, while Wubben-Moy suffered a muscle injury and required a scan. The additions of Kelly and Parker provide depth to the England squad ahead of the Nations League fixtures.

Upcoming Matches

The Lionesses squad, consisting of 24 players, will gather at St George's Park before heading to the Algarve to play against Portugal in the opening Nations League game. They will then face Spain in a highly anticipated rematch of the 2023 World Cup final at Wembley on Feb 26.
